Transaction d3124c66a63f5e524daab8aae22c5acc0207988299a98771eb38493d2d58f574
1 Input
1 Output
-
d3124c66a63f5e524daab8aae22c5acc0207988299a98771eb38493d2d58f574:0
- value
- 1765570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efc4cb385493a22890f65455bba4c790b663d90e OP_EQUAL
- address
- 3PYoAsBu77pf8TbyZ94qjGPS2oKVugz3Ym